1. 程式人生 > >全球第一開源ERP Odoo操作手冊 啟用多核來提升Odoo性能

全球第一開源ERP Odoo操作手冊 啟用多核來提升Odoo性能

ogr 過多 ogre dash web mil mit ner 利用

Odoo 10.0通過多核設置,可自動分配出多進程,從而充分利用CPU,大幅提高系統性能。

1.8.1 復制缺失的文件

從官方網站下載的源碼中復制 openerp-gevent /usr/bin 目錄下。

1.8.2 安裝需要的模塊

sudo apt-get install python-gevent

sudo apt-get install python-setuptools

sudo easy_install psycogreen

sudo easy_install greenlet

1.8.3 設置使用多核

編輯 odoo.conf

編輯或增加

workers = n 其中“

n”為你的 cpu 的內核數量。

limit_time_cpu = 300 值可以適當加大

limit_time_real = 360 值可以適當加大

最後重啟 Odoo 服務

sudo service odoo restart

註意:

開啟多核後,請務必使用上節(1.8節)介紹的Nginx反向代理。這是因為開啟多核後,會有很多線程在端口8069上,但也有一個 gevent線程在端口8072(longpolling-port)web會用8069請求longpolling。所以會出現 http錯誤。

文章編輯:PS Cloud——源自歐洲,連接中國。開源雲ERP,賦能成長型企業。

https://www.mypscloud.com

全球第一開源ERP Odoo操作手冊 啟用多核來提升Odoo性能